U.S. President Biden will continue COVID-19 vaccination appeal


After his administration fell short of its Independence Day vaccination goal, U.S. President Joe Biden on Tuesday will again appeal to uninoculated Americans to get the shots to protect themselves and others against the coronavirus, especially the latest worrying variant. Biden is scheduled to make remarks at the White House on the COVID-19 response and the vaccination program as concern increases about the delta variant of the virus spreading across the country. The Biden administration aimed to have 70% of American adults at least partially vaccinated against COVID-19 by July 4. Businesses are opening and hiring again,” Biden told the attendees during a 15-minute speech in which he declared near independence from the pandemic. “Don’t get me wrong — COVID-19 has not been vanquished,” said Biden.
